Don't Let Downtime Disrupt You: A Tailored Disaster Recovery Plan

In today’s highly interconnected world, enterprises rely heavily on their IT infrastructure. A single disruption can have devastating consequences for your operations. That’s why it’s critical to have a well-defined disaster recovery plan in place. A tailored plan acts as your protection against unforeseen events, ensuring that you can efficiently restore your systems and minimize business disruptions.

Rather than relying on a generic template, it’s vital to develop a plan that is specific to the unique needs of your organization. This involves assessing your critical systems, data, and requirements, and then formulating a step-by-step plan for mitigating potential risks.

A comprehensive disaster recovery plan should comprise several key elements:

  • Risk assessment and analysis
  • Business impact analysis
  • Recovery time objectives (RTOs) and recovery point objectives (RPOs)
  • Data backup and recovery procedures
  • System redundancy and failover mechanisms
  • Communication plan
  • Testing and maintenance

By adopting a tailored disaster recovery plan, you can proactively minimize the impact of potential outages, protect your valuable data, and ensure that your business can continue functioning in the face of adversity.

Emerging from the Cloud: Hybrid Disaster Recovery for Modern Businesses

In today's dynamic digital landscape, businesses need to a robust and reliable disaster recovery strategy. While cloud computing has transformed IT infrastructure, relying solely on the cloud for disaster recovery can present certain risks. A hybrid approach, which leverages both cloud and on-premises resources, offers a more resilient solution.

Hybrid disaster recovery allows businesses to maximize the benefits of cloud agility while maintaining custody over critical data and applications. By distributing workloads across multiple environments, organizations can reduce downtime and ensure business continuity in data security solutions the event of a incident.

Adopting a hybrid disaster recovery strategy involves several key components:

* **Cloud-based DRaaS solutions:** Provide on-demand resources for failover and data replication.

* **On-premises infrastructure:** Serves as a primary site for critical applications and data.

* **Robust networking:** Ensures seamless connectivity between cloud and on-premises environments.

* **Automated orchestration tools:** Streamline disaster recovery procedures.

Moreover, a well-designed hybrid disaster recovery plan should include comprehensive documentation, regular testing and training to guarantee preparedness in the face of unforeseen events.
